One huge advantage of Korg styles, is a variation pattern can be up to 32 bars long. Makes for very little repetition. One can even enter a full SMF (yes a full song if you like) as intro 1. This option is only available for the intro 1 slot however. Can make it really cool to have a "just like the record" version of a song as the intro and then jump into all your variations to do your own interpretation....Although I doubt whether this can be achieved using vA.

These are just a couple of the very cool things one can do with Korg styles.

pax_eterna

AKAIK know Jon this is not the case. Yamaha can go to an 8 bar pattern (although rarely used) and Roland 16 (but only in later styles)  not sure about Ketron, but I  think theirs is 8, might be 16 though. And NONE allow you to enter in a complete midi file as an intro...no conversion, any key you like and just paste it into the intro 1 slot...a very handy tool...
